If you add a message "bla hu" as well, the issue becomes even clearer, as that will be sent to the "miss" outlet of [route 1 bla]. However as mixing floats and symbols in route's arguments is explicitly forbidden according to the help-patch, it's a moot issue to discuss for now.
If mixing floats and symbols is forbidden, then it really should be
forbidden. For example, the object shouldn't create if there are
mixed float and symbol arguments. Currently, it works sometimes,
plus there are no warnings or errors issued.
